The term field experiment refers to any fully randomized research design in which people or other observational units found in a natural setting are assigned to treatment and control conditions. The typical field experiment uses a two-group, post-test-only control group design (campbell and stanley, 1963).

The theory and results of two experimental methods for estimating the modal damping of a wind turbine during operation are presented. Estimations of the aeroelastic damping of the operational turbine modes (including the effects of the aerodynamic forces) give a quantitative view of the stability characteristics of the turbine.

The simple experiment is one of the most basic methods of determining if there is a cause-and-effect relationship between two variables. A simple experiment utilizes a control group of participants who receive no treatment and an experimental group of participants who receive the treatment.
